Repair or replace: the call we make in the parking lot

A technician in Auto Glass Repair Sanford, NC: Repair First, Replace When Needed makes the repair-versus-replace call with three variables: size, location, and structure.

Cracks longer than roughly 6 to 8 inches usually put you in windshield replacement Fayetteville NC territory. Chips and short cracks away from the driver’s primary line of sight and more than a couple of inches from the edge are often candidates for windshield repair Fayetteville NC. If a crack touches the edge or runs from it, structural integrity becomes the priority. That glass bonded to the pinch weld helps hold the roof up in a rollover. No tech with a conscience will patch a compromised safety component.

It’s similar with side window repair Fayetteville NC. Side glass is tempered, not laminated, and when it breaks it turns into a thousand pebbles. There’s no repairing that. Side window replacement Fayetteville NC is the only route, and the good news is it’s typically straightforward and quick. Back glass replacement Fayetteville NC follows the same rule. If your rear defroster grid is a mess of glitter, you’re getting a new panel. For some vehicles with laminated rear glass, back glass repair Fayetteville NC can be an option, but it’s rare in our market.

Chips, cracks, and the myths that cost people money

I’ve watched a small rock chip sit harmlessly for months, then spread overnight after a cold snap. The culprit is almost always moisture and temperature swings. A chip that looks like a tiny crater can hide microfractures. Air enters, heat hits the glass, the inner layer expands, and the crack runs. If you catch it early, auto glass chip repair Fayetteville NC or rock chip repair Fayetteville NC is inexpensive and fast, usually covered by insurance with no deductible.

Two myths to retire:

  • “It’s tiny, I’ll wait.” Water and heat don’t wait. Windshield chip repair Fayetteville NC works best within days, not months.
  • “Resin fixes everything.” It doesn’t. A crack through the laminate or across the driver’s sightline calls for cracked windshield repair Fayetteville NC via replacement to protect both safety and visibility.

Costs you can predict, and where the money goes

People ask how much does windshield replacement cost Fayetteville NC and expect one number. I prefer ranges because they’re real. Most mainstream windshields fall between 250 and 550 dollars installed for vehicles without ADAS. Add rain sensors, acoustic lamination, HUD, or camera mounts, and the cost can reach 450 to 900 dollars. Luxury models and heated windshields live beyond that.

Windshield repair sits at a fraction of those numbers, often 80 to 150 dollars for a chip, with incremental charges for multiple impacts. Side glass typically runs 180 to 450 dollars depending on doors, trim complexity, and part availability. Back glass can be 250 to 600 dollars, sometimes more if the defroster and antenna are integrated.

What drives price:

  • Glass spec: OEM windshield Fayetteville NC carries manufacturer branding and tight tolerances, and it costs more. A quality aftermarket windshield Fayetteville NC can save 15 to 35 percent and perform well when sourced from reputable brands.
  • Calibration: Expect an additional 150 to 350 dollars for ADAS calibration depending on whether your vehicle requires dynamic road calibration, static target boards, or both.
  • Sealants and primers: Premium urethane costs more, but it delivers safer drive-away times and better bond strength. Not negotiable if you value your roof strength.
  • Labor and teardown: Frameless doors with delicate trims, hidden clips, or stubborn urethane beds add time.

Plenty of folks search for cheap windshield replacement Fayetteville NC. Cheap can be fine if it means efficient scheduling and good aftermarket glass. It’s not fine if it means skipping pinch-weld primer or using low-modulus sealants that never fully cure in humidity. Ask what urethane they use, and if they warranty against leaks and stress cracks. Reputable shops do.

Insurance and the little details that save you headaches

Insurance auto glass Fayetteville NC claims are straightforward when you know the process. If you carry comprehensive, most insurers waive the deductible for rock chip repair. Replacement usually applies your comp deductible. Direct billing is common, so you don’t have to float the cost. Confirm whether you prefer insurance windshield replacement Fayetteville NC with OEM glass or if your policy allows equivalent aftermarket. Some carriers will default to aftermarket unless your vehicle is within a certain age or has ADAS restrictions.

A practical tip: file the claim while the tech is en route. The shop can help with claim numbers, but only you can authorize. Front versus rear: different glass, different rules

Front glass does heavy lifting. It contributes to airbag deployment angles, resists roof crush, and holds camera mounts steady. That’s why front windshield replacement Fayetteville NC gets the strictest adhesives and cure windows. Rear windshield replacement Fayetteville NC, often called back glass replacement, is more straightforward. It still seals your cabin and powers the defroster, but it doesn’t bear the same structural load.

One tricky edge case: hatchbacks and SUVs sometimes hide a wiper motor path that can snag if reassembled out of sequence. If your rear wiper sweeps once and stops post-install, your tech should address it, not shrug. SUV windshield replacement Fayetteville NC also raises the question of acoustic glass. Some SUVs ship with laminated acoustic fronts and tempered rears. Mixing types across trims can change cabin noise. Good shops match spec so your ride sounds the same as it did from the factory.

Calibration without drama

Auto glass Fort Liberty NC jobs increasingly include ADAS. Each manufacturer plays by its own rulebook. Dynamic calibration requires a road test at a specific speed with markers in view. Static calibration demands a level surface, precise targets, and no heavy metal objects nearby that could skew radar or camera alignment. Some vehicles need both.

If your tech says calibration isn’t necessary after replacing a windshield with a camera mount, ask how they know. Some vehicles self-calibrate after a short drive, but many need a scan tool session. When in doubt, look in the service manual or ask for the shop’s calibration policy. If they offer windshield calibration Fayetteville NC with a printed result, you’re in safer hands.

Weather, curing, and North Carolina reality

Summer in Fayetteville means heat, humidity, and afternoon storms that appear out of nowhere. Urethane chemistry loves warm temperatures but hates sudden soaking. Your tech will gauge the sky, choose the right adhesive, and may suggest an earlier slot to avoid rain risk. Winter mornings drop enough that cure times lengthen. Don’t rush the drive-away window; that bond is your safety belt for the windshield.

If weather looks rough, a carport or garage is perfect. Apartment covered parking works well if the ceiling height allows hatch opening for back glass work. If you can’t provide cover, the tech brings canopies or reschedules quickly. Better a well-bonded windshield tomorrow than a rushed one today.

Choosing between OEM and aftermarket: a pragmatic view

Some drivers insist on OEM glass, especially if the vehicle is under warranty or has calibrated HUD graphics. Others prefer a high-quality aftermarket windshield that lowers cost without compromising performance. Both can be right.

Choose OEM when:

  • Your HUD is sensitive or ghosting is a concern.
  • You’ve had repeated calibration drift with a particular aftermarket brand.
  • Your insurer approves OEM at no extra cost.

Choose reputable aftermarket when:

  • You want to keep the windshield replacement cost Fayetteville NC manageable.
  • Your vehicle’s ADAS is simple or non-existent.
  • Your shop vouches for the specific brand’s optical clarity and wiper track.

The skill of the installer matters more than the logo etched in the corner. A perfect aftermarket install beats a sloppy OEM job every time.
